Abstract

The Bianchi type-V universe with massive scalar fields and domain walls examined within f(R, T) theory of gravity described by Harko et al. (Phys. Rev. D. 84, 024020, 2011). Solving the  field equations of the theory using a power law relation between the scalar field and average scale factor of the model we have presented an anisotropic massive scalar  field model in this modified theory of gravity. In light of the recent scenario of the universe expanding at an accelerated rate and cosmological observations, we computed the cosmological parameters like energy density, pressure, deceleration parameter (q), statefinder parameters (r,s), and r-q plane of our model and discussed their physical significance.
